Hossana haleluyah happiness Poem by OLUDARE SAMSON ALADE

Hossana haleluyah happiness

Glory upon glory is his depth.
Time and time again is his power.
Every ride on a tide and waves;
Teaches his honour.
Let men cease to sing his praise.
Then stones, trees, birds and asunder;
Will sing his praise.
Lord of lords, it is being said;
King of kings, as it is being said.
Arise Oh Lord, let your foes scatter.
Ancient of Days in alpha and Omega.
The Almighty of the mighty are your host.
Lord of hosts is his name, Hossana in the highest.
